The Center on International Development seeks to explore comprehensive and creative solutions to some of the world's most complex international policy issues. On a by-region basis, the center will tackle a wide range of issues, including political infrastructure, human rights, economic development and investment, poverty reduction, and disaster relief. The Center welcomes progressive writers with expertise in any area of international development. Members share a passion for cultural and political awareness, and a desire to rise to challenges much larger than themselves.
